Top 3 Best 40207 Kentucky Private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 11 private schools serving 3,756 students in 40207, KY (there are 5 public schools, serving 2,354 public students). 61% of all K-12 students in 40207, KY are educated in private schools (compared to the KY state average of 9%).
The top ranked private schools in 40207, KY include Trinity High School, Our Lady Of Lourdes School and Holy Trinity Parish School.
The average acceptance rate is 98%, which is higher than the Kentucky private school average acceptance rate of 93%.
73% of private schools in 40207, KY are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Presbyterian).
